The Essence of a Deposition
In legal parlance, a deposition is a formal statement or testimony taken under oath, usually outside of court, wherein witnesses provide their accounts of relevant facts pertaining to a case. This process is quintessential in litigation, serving to elucidate the matter at hand and garner insight into the perspectives of those involved. The deposition stands as a pivotal conduit through which legal strategists glean information that may either bolster or undermine their respective positions.
Depositions bear a distinct format. Typically, they are recorded by a court reporter and may be transcribed onto paper, ensuring meticulous documentation of the proceedings. This documented testimony can later be utilized in court to substantiate claims, challenge the credibility of a witness, or even settle disputes without necessitating a trial. Witnesses, often referred to as deponents, are summoned to recount their experiences, observations, or specialized knowledge related to the case.
The Significance of Depositions in Legal Strategy
One might ponder: why are depositions so vital? The answer lies in their multifarious functionalities. Primarily, they serve as an instrument for discovery. Lawyers exploit depositions to uncover facts that are not readily accessible through traditional discovery methods such as interrogatories or requests for production of documents. This pretrial phase cultivates an environment where parties can crystallize their arguments and better prepare themselves for the impending courtroom drama.
Moreover, depositions afford both sides an opportunity to assess the strengths and weaknesses of their cases. An earnest appraisal of testimony can spotlight contradictions, bolster or debilitate claims, and even precipitate settlements. The efficacy of a deposition is often predicated on the adeptness of the attorney conducting it. The ability to wield incisive questions that compel thoughtful responses is an art and a science—an intricate ballet of legal acumen and psychological insight.
The Dynamics of Conducting a Deposition
Conducting a deposition is a nuanced endeavor. Attorney competencies converge in this arena as they navigate the convoluted waters of witness interrogation. Various techniques are employed to elicit comprehensive responses, ranging from leading questions to open-ended inquiries that pave the way for expansive discourse. It is here that the court reporter plays an indispensable role, ensuring that every nuance, every hesitance, and every inflection is meticulously documented.
While depositions are invaluable, the process is not without its challenges. Witnesses may exhibit reluctance, uncertainty, or outright hostility. The emotional undercurrents present in a deposition may lead to evasive responses or, conversely, emotional outbursts. Attorneys must maintain decorum while simultaneously striving to extract the truth. This balancing act requires exceptional skill, emotional intelligence, and often, a touch of empathy.

The Evolving Landscape of Depositions
As technology ushers in a new era, the deposition landscape is not immune to transformation. Traditional in-person depositions are increasingly supplemented—or even replaced—by virtual depositions conducted via video conferencing platforms. This evolution offers myriad benefits, including greater accessibility, reduced costs, and heightened flexibility. However, it is imperative to navigate the technological intricacies with care; ensuring that all participants remain engaged and the integrity of the testimony is preserved.
